Bought this truck for specific reasons,(tow a 7000 pound boat and a work truck that holds full sheets of plywood) and it seems to do what I bought it for. Towed my boat from Long Island to Boston, a couple of hundred miles with no issues. Still getting used to it has great acceleration, comfortable on the highway, hauls my work trailer effortlessly, and has decent gas mileage for a full size truck. It is not the most luxurious but I knew that when I bought it and sort of like that about it and wish it did get better mileage but can’t have the power it does and mileage too but if there is one thing I can say I don’t like when driving is a blind spot to the right forward of the side mirrors. It is probably typical in all larger trucks but it is a concern to be cautious of. Overall I like the truck very much so far.

Great Truck - Entune JBL stereo is a JOKE

skidds, 09/17/2018
2018 Toyota Tundra Platinum 4dr CrewMax 4WD SB (5.7L 8cyl 6A)
13 of 19 people found this review helpful

Purchased a fully loaded Tundra Platinum Crewmax and Love the truck, but need to spend some money to replace the JBL stereo upgrade that came with the truck. The Entune JBL Stereo is by far the worst radio I have had in any vehicle that I have owned in the last 30 years. I have a couple other Toyota cars, and the Entune system is poorly designed , but the JBL System takes that poor design to another level. Completely under powered system. At full volume you can still talk to the other passengers in the Truck.

Outdated 2018 Toyota Tundra

Matt, 11/07/2018
2018 Toyota Tundra SR5 4dr CrewMax SB (5.7L 8cyl 6A)
7 of 10 people found this review helpful

I love the updated exterior body style and LED headlights . However the interior is the same as my 2012 Toyota Corolla I had . Nothing has changed in about 6 years . The tundra is lagging behind in the other brands when it comes to technology and interior . The gas mileage on this truck is pretty terrible for 2018 . I average about 15 mpg and that’s babying it at all times . Not offering a push to start is very irritating as well . My 2016 Tacoma had one but the 2018 Tundra doesn’t offer one . Doesn’t make much sense . Regretting on leasing this vehicle .
